How much do entry level process td engineer intel j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 5, 2026, the average yearly pay for entry level process td engineer intel in the United States is $92,018.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$74,500.00 and $103,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Entry Level Process Td Engineer Intel vs Entry Level Manufacturing Engineer?

AspectEntry Level Process Td Engineer IntelEntry Level Manufacturing Engineer
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Engineering, Electrical, or related field; internship experienceBachelor's in Mechanical, Industrial, or related engineering; internship experience
Work EnvironmentSemiconductor fabrication facilities, R&D labsManufacturing plants, production lines
Industry UsageSemiconductor industry, tech companiesAutomotive, consumer electronics, industrial manufacturing
Common Search IntentUnderstanding roles in semiconductor process developmentUnderstanding manufacturing process roles

Entry Level Process Td Engineer Intel primarily focuses on developing and optimizing semiconductor manufacturing processes within Intel's fabrication facilities. In contrast, Entry Level Manufacturing Engineers work across various industries to improve production efficiency and quality in manufacturing plants. While both roles require engineering degrees and internship experience, their work environments and industry applications differ significantly.

Job Summary
Dennis Group's Process Engineers are key in our projects of designing and building food and beverage processing facilities. Process Engineers work in every aspect of a project - controls, packaging, mechanical, electrical, building system, architecture, etc., from the conceptual stages to design completion, and throughout construction. They provide expertise in flow diagrams, alterations, constraints, piping and instrumentation diagrams (P&ID), layout, install, and commissioning and start-up. Process Engineers enable operational efficiencies for the food and beverage process plants of our clients. Responsibilities will include, but not be limited to:
Responsibilities
  • Develop process design basis and select unit operations
  • Develop operation specifications
  • Coordinate with other project disciplines (engineers, designers, architects, etc.)
  • Prepare process flow and piping and instrumentation diagrams
  • Create process flow diagrams
  • Prepare mass and energy balances
  • Size and specify process and process utility equipment
  • Equipment procurement and bid evaluation
  • Assist project management with the development of project scope, budget and schedule for all process related work
  • Help to coordinate the schedules and work of contractors for process equipment installation
  • Work with clients, vendors, and suppliers to develop cost estimates and proposals
  • Provide client assumptions on supply recommendations
  • Develop process and instrumentation drawings (P&IDs)
  • Oversee process and utility equipment installations
  • Provide onsite construction start-up and commissioning support
  • Research process engineering best practices
  • Supporting talent growth within our organization
